当前位置:   article > 正文

pipenv pyinstaller虚环境打包流程_pipenv 没有main.spec

pipenv 没有main.spec

1、在项目文件夹中创建一个空文件夹A,命名随便

2、进入该文件夹A,在地址栏输入cmd调起命令行,也可以先调起命令行,然后CD到这里

3、pip install pipenv

4、创建对应python版本的虚环境:pipenv --python 3.7(这步可以忽略)

5、创建虚环境:pipenv install

6、进入虚环境:pipenv shell

7、在虚环境中pip依赖库:pip install xxx

8、在虚环境中安装pyinstaller依赖库:pip install pyinstaller

9、进行首次打包,这里是打包成一个exe:pyinstaller -F filename.py

10、进入文件夹A下的dist文件夹,运行里面的filename.exe,看是否正常运行、各功能是否正常

11、如果filename.exe无法正常运行,看控制台的报错信息,一般都是找不到依赖库导致的,因此,修改文件夹A下的main.spec文件,在hiddenimports里面加上报错的依赖库名,这是一个列表,因此以str的方式加,然后再次pyinstaller打包:pyinstaller main.spec

12、如果还有问题,以及打包中遇到其他问题,百度、请教同事吧~

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/不正经/article/detail/657379
推荐阅读
相关标签
  

闽ICP备14008679号